Output dd4af56e8f6ca2e4be265807f6979ae219931e060ba1c123cabf13c0eef13048:43

value
2525951
script pubkey
OP_0 OP_PUSHBYTES_20 4f4ee245c819815cf97bbc59983d38e57911a7c4
address
bc1qfa8wy3wgrxq4e7tmh3ves0fcu4u3rf7yh69zfm
transaction
dd4af56e8f6ca2e4be265807f6979ae219931e060ba1c123cabf13c0eef13048
confirmations
15145
spent
true